An Edgar Award–winning novelist, THOMAS ADCOCK is a veteran newspaper and magazine journalist. He divides his time between a Manhattan apartment and an 18th century farmhouse in upstate New York. He is the coeditor of Brooklyn Noir 3: Nothing but the Truth.
